A 12-week JAMA study tracking 135 subjects found body fat and weight loss in the group taking garcinia cambogia’s active compound didn’t significantly differ from the placebo group — a direct contradiction to Forever Garcinia Plus’s core ingredient claim. This review checked what the rest of the research says.
How We Researched This Forever Garcinia Plus Review
This review checked the published research on hydroxycitric acid (HCA) specifically across multiple studies, plus the supporting evidence for chromium picolinate and carob extract, the formula’s other notable ingredients.
Forever Garcinia Plus Review: What Is It?
Made by Forever Living (an MLM company), Forever Garcinia Plus is a soft-gel supplement built around garcinia cambogia extract (HCA), plus safflower oil, MCT oil, carob extract, and chromium picolinate, marketed to suppress appetite and prevent fat storage.
What the Research on Key Ingredients Shows — A Genuinely Mixed Picture
- Asia Pacific Journal of Clinical Nutrition: HCA effectively reduced body fat in obese women over two months compared to placebo — a genuine, favorable short-term finding.
- Physiology & Behavior: a 12-week study of 42 participants found no significant evidence that garcinia cambogia suppresses appetite when taken before meals.
- Journal of the American Medical Association: a 12-week study of 135 subjects found body fat and weight loss in the HCA group didn’t significantly differ from placebo — a direct contradiction to the ingredient’s core marketed benefit.
Genuinely Contradictory Core Evidence
This is worth stating plainly: research on garcinia cambogia’s active compound is directly split, with one study finding real fat reduction and another, larger JAMA study finding no significant difference from placebo at all. This isn’t a minor nuance — it’s a real, unresolved contradiction in the evidence for the product’s primary ingredient.

The Supporting Ingredients Fare Somewhat Better
Chromium picolinate has real research support for increasing lean body mass and decreasing body fat percentage, and carob extract has genuine research support for aiding weight loss and treating obesity — both more consistent findings than the core garcinia cambogia ingredient itself.
A Genuine Nutritional Bonus
Beyond the weight-loss claims, Forever Garcinia Plus delivers real, verifiable amounts of calcium (up to 30% of daily value at full dosage) and iron (2-6%) — a genuine secondary nutritional benefit independent of whether the core weight-loss mechanism works.
Real Allergen Considerations
The formula contains soy and beeswax, both common allergens, alongside gelatin, glycerin, safflower oil, and carob — real, specific ingredients anyone with relevant allergies needs to check carefully before use.
Does Forever Garcinia Plus Work?
The core garcinia cambogia/HCA evidence is genuinely split, with a notable JAMA study finding no real effect. Chromium and carob extract have more consistent, favorable research support. Most studies run only 12 weeks, so long-term effectiveness genuinely remains unstudied.
Who Forever Garcinia Plus Actually Makes Sense For
This fits people comfortable with genuinely mixed evidence on the core ingredient who want the secondary calcium and chromium benefits, particularly those without soy or beeswax allergies. It’s a poor fit for anyone expecting reliable appetite suppression specifically, given the direct research against that claim.

The Bottom Line
Forever Garcinia Plus’s core garcinia cambogia ingredient has genuinely contradictory research, including a notable JAMA study finding no real effect, though supporting ingredients like chromium and carob extract fare better. This Forever Garcinia Plus review found a supplement whose central claim doesn’t hold up consistently across the available research.
